Drive the distribution of complex trade finance solutions across global markets
We are looking for a commercially driven Senior Associate/Vice President to join a growing Trade Distribution team within a leading international bank.
In this role, you will work at the intersection of origination, structuring, and distribution of trade finance assets, helping to optimize portfolio performance and unlock new growth opportunities.
You will collaborate with internal and external stakeholders—including banks, investors, and corporate clients—to bring complex transactions to market.
Your impact- Structure and distribute trade finance solutions
, including Supply Chain Finance and Receivables Finance transactions - Drive portfolio optimization
, using techniques such as syndication, sell-downs, and credit risk mitigation - Support and lead client engagements
, including pitches and RfP processes - Build relationships with financial institutions and investors to expand distribution capacity
- Coordinate cross-functional execution
, working with teams across sales, risk, legal, and product management. - Contribute to developing scalable processes and innovative transaction structures
